It was a late September night when muffled blasts and a stream of bubbles broke the surface of the Baltic Sea. Explosions had ...
Trump's warning about Russian gas dependence proved prophetic as Europe now imports 57% of gas from U.S. instead of Russia ...
Despite US objections, India continues to be a major buyer of Russian crude oil, ranking second globally in October with $2.5 ...
If India yields to US pressure and stops buying oil from Russia, it would seriously undermine its narrative of strategic ...